Output 3abda98e234fef151542a9c6010286463dcca13d392487eed824bb15cde87509:0

value
22612158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c49c7204694ff11e28e850538d38d4a6f759a2e5 OP_EQUAL
address
3KcbnA7zvwkzy8pKYvPkys3td4bijwLjbL
transaction
3abda98e234fef151542a9c6010286463dcca13d392487eed824bb15cde87509
spent
true